FANS voiced concern for boxing legend Butterbean after he made a return to the wrestling ring.
The American – real name Eric Esch – became a star in the 1990s and early 2000s thanks to his knockout power and 26 STONE frame.

And he also ventured into kickboxing, MMA and professional wrestling – even having a stint in the WWE.
Butterbean’s last fight was in 2013, a boxing bout he lost to Kirk Lawton in Australia.
But in retirement, Butterbean has dramatically transformed his body and lost an incredible 16 stone with the help of wrestler Diamond Dallas Page.
And Butterbean actually returned to the wrestling ring for a match against Minoru Suzuki in Las Vegas.
